The [[vasculature]] is a network of blood vessels connecting the heart with all other organs and tissues in the body. Arteries and arterioles bring oxygen-rich blood and nutrients from the heart to the organs and tissues, while venules and veins carry deoxygenated blood back to the heart vascular_anatomy.txt Last modified: 2024/06/07 02:55by 127.0.0.1
